The room (sleeping 3) was clean and spacious. It faces the back, so it was quiet despite major road and traffic going by the front of the building. Convenient location: Shopping center with Aldi is in 10-minute walking distance, and bus stop with connection to the city center right in front of the hotel. (You don't need a car in the city of Edinburgh). Staff wasn't overly friendly. The gentleman working at the reception disappeared when he saw my heavy suitcase...So did housekeeping upon check-out. Please provide lock boxes in the rooms and some shelves in the bathroom. Overall, my stay was pleasant and served my needs. I would stay there again (with less luggage...;))

⭐️ 1/5 – Absolutely disgraceful experience This was hands down one of the worst hotel stays I’ve ever had. From the moment we arrived, the staff made it very clear they did not want to attend to us. There was one Greek staff member in particular who was outright rude and dismissive. He seemed to live in what looked like a room next to reception and acted as though coming out to do his actual job was a personal inconvenience. Our room was NEVER cleaned in the four days we stayed. Not once. For £307 for three nights, the bare minimum expectation would be a made bed and fresh towels daily. Instead, we were met with attitude when we asked at reception. We were told, with visible annoyance, that towels would only be changed if we threw them on the floor. We did exactly that and guess what? Still no towel change. I had to repeatedly ask for clean towels just to shower, and each time I was made to feel like I was asking for something unreasonable. The attitude was shocking. The cleanliness was beyond unacceptable. The cleaners are clearly not doing their jobs. The two coffee mugs provided were filthy. I will be attaching photos because it was genuinely disgusting. The toilet was dirty, surfaces were dirty, everything felt unclean. This was not a hotel-level standard by any stretch. The whole place felt more like a poorly run house share or room accommodation pretending to be a hotel.

Genuinely the worst experience I have had at a hotel. I haven’t felt so uncomfortable in my life in another accommodation. The person at the main reception had no respect and an attitude problem from the moment we walked in. When we got to the room, there was an unknown red substance on the wall, hair in the bed and on a freezing cold night in Scotland, no working radiator. I made them aware of this issue, they provided me a small heater. I advised I couldn’t leave it on all night and the response I got was an abrupt ‘sorry about that’ as he walked out the room. I was expecting at the very least a sincere apology and a room change but this was never offered and just assumed we would be happy with a tiny heater. As my partner and I were VERY uncomfortable and couldn’t stay in a room without a working radiator, we made the decision to go home a night early. When I handed the keys back, the attitude we got from the owner and disgusted look was horrible. I let him know I was uncomfortable and unhappy and that Expedia have contacted him to resolve this multiple times but he refused their calls. If you ever come to Edinburgh, never even think about this hotel. The worst one I have ever been to. Save your money or spend on a better place. It’s worth it.

Microwave was removed from property, listing said it had microwave and refrig. The fridge was downstairs in dining room that was shared with all guests at hotel. Caused a huge inconvenience as we were unable to put things in the fridge after 10p and had no microwave to reheat. The prices were tripled because of the festival . The internet was out half of our time there. These 2 things caused us extra expenses (not able to eat left overs, had to pay for out of the country internet services while the internet was out) that we weren’t prepared to pay. Manager was no help with directions how to use bus services and was extremely rude. Housekeeping services were every other day. The housekeepers were awesome but the manager wasn’t available at the desk before 11a and after 10pm. I wouldn’t stay here again. 8 nights equaled $3,000 American dollars with no internet and no microwave . No fridge in room as claimed on sight. Will be filing a complaint with Expedia.
